(ANSA) – ROME, JUN 16 – The Australian Minister of Energy has urged families in New South Wales, the state that also includes Sydney, to turn off the lights in the evening to deal with the energy crisis. This was reported by the BBC, underlining that the minister Chris Bowen has called for limiting the use of electricity to two hours per evening if “they have an alternative”.
The call comes after Australia’s main wholesale electricity market was suspended due to rising prices.
“If you have a choice when to do some activities, don’t do them 6-8pm,” he said at a televised press conference in Canberra. (HANDLE).
